Can we change our annual meeting date from October to Late August as requested by Unit owners and Trustees?
Mister Condo replies:
P.Z., there are many reasons that associations decide to change their annual meeting dates. As long as the rules for making that change are followed, it is allowable. Most likely, an amendment to the governing documents will be required. That means a motion to make the change and proper notice to all involved in making the vote. Once the vote is held and the date has been changed, all unit owners have to be properly noticed according to both the governing documents and state law. All future owners need to be provided with updated amended documents alerting them to the annual meeting date change. As long as all of the steps are followed properly, the date can be changed.
